SEER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2023 in Review

90 of the 6,860 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Seer Inc (SEER) for Q4 2023, worth a combined $73.8M — down 15% from $86.7M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 30 funds opened new SEER positions and 17 closed out — a net gain of 13 holders — while 29 added to existing stakes and 20 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$1.24M. The largest seller was Capital World Investors, cutting an estimated $3.64M.
